Catalog description

In this elective course, candidates will review human rights, and social justice standards as well as identifying historical and current challenges to achieving social justice. They will learn strategies to educate varied populations on stereotypes and prejudice regarding race, ethnicity, age, gender, socioeconomic class, disabilities and other social markers of difference. Candidates will review relevant literature and design and pursue a community partnership to collaboratively address a social justice issue or implement a social justice education program for a group with whom they assume a leadership role. Prerequisite: MONT 804, MONT 812, or Permission of the Program Director. (As Offered).
